So, let's start with: Download this app>run app scan (while the scan is running)> using your phone Bluetooth scan here (you should then see the connection) iRV36 (in my case)> connect to it. close out the app and you are now connected. That is how I was able to connect via BT. it does work, but making the connection is horrible in my opinion, once connected it works fine.

App is terrible and seems to have no functuonality at all. BUT bluetooth connection is possible. As others have said IV36 appears twice in your phone's bluetooth list. Pick both of them, one should connect. The BT on the unit should change from red to blue. Then you can at least stream music. I just change zones etc on the hardware not the app.
